nginx-ldap-auth-service

nginx-ldap-auth-service provides a daemon (nginx-ldap-auth) that communicates with an LDAP or Active Directory server to authenticate users with their username and password, as well as a login form for actually allowing users to authenticate. You can use this in combination with the nginx module ngx_http_auth_request_module to provide authentication for your nginx server.
